Dana discusses bullying and how it has changed in this new digital age, how life-altering the effects of bullying can be, and how it’s being swept under the rug by schools who are more concerned with perception and reputation and parents who are in denial. Dana’s daughter was bullied and harassed to the point she became critically ill - she spent several months in the hospital, missed over a year of school and she had to move out of the community she and her family had lived in for more than 20 years. The effects of the constant abuse have been catastrophic for her family and have stolen her daughter’s childhood. She was failed by a system that appears to be more concerned with public perception and reputation as well as parents who seem to refuse to believe that their children are anything but perfect.
